Thermal housing is designed to protect thermal imaging cameras (thermal imagers) from environmental influences. It is used in security and technological video surveillance systems. |
|||
Explosion protection marking 1Ex db IIC T6 Gb / Ex tb IIIC T85°C Db allows the use of the Relion-T-A thermal housing in explosive zones of classes "1" and "2". | |||

The body of the thermal housing is made of aluminum alloy AD31T5 |
|||
A special germanium glass is installed in the viewing window of the thermal housing, which does not interfere with the IR radiation of the object of observation. |
|||
Complete dust and water tight housing - IP66/68 |
|||
Housing power supply according to PoE technology according to IEEE 802.3at standard - version 11 |

When choosing a switch for a thermal enclosure, there are two parameters to consider when using PoE technology: the maximum power that the switch can provide per port and the overall PoE power budget of the switch. The maximum power consumption of the video camera must not exceed the allocated power per switch port, and the total maximum power consumption of the video cameras must not exceed the total PoE power budget of the switch. |

Automatic mode of maintaining the temperature of the inner space of the thermal jacket. |
|||
Automatic heating of the inner space of the thermal housing before a cold start, which ensures a safe operation of the thermal imager. |
|||
Stabilized supply voltage for the thermal imager. |
|||
Emergency power off of the thermal imager at a temperature in the thermal casing above +55°С. |
